The Razer Ring Light has 192 LEDs that pass through a white diffuser.
What this means in practice is that the light spreads nice and even.
Combined with the shape of the light, any and all harsh shadows are banished for good.
Just as important as the light is the tripod that the Razer Ring Light is attached to.
Its a two-in-one deal that provides an excellent source of light and a place for your camera!
